Thanks for any info! Didn’t realize they were doing waitlists since the restart. Did you book with PCL or a TA? They used to advise by email, but it was hit or miss. Check your booking every day and see if you have a cabin assigned. In fact, watch the website to see if a cabin opens in your waitlisted category, call your TA immediately to grab the cabin or PCL, if you booked directly. If this is a guaranteed GTY cabin or an UG bid, then that’s a whole different story. Those can be assigned right up to sailing date.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

SCX22 Posted December 12, 2023 #6 Share Posted December 12, 2023 Highly unlikely that you will be accommodated on to this cruise. It's too close to departure. In order for there space to become available, someone would have to cancel. Canceling this close to a cruise would entail an FCC and/or having to go through insurance, which aren't optimal outcomes. I've had relatives who waitlisted for cruises and were accommodated after final payment had passed because people with reservations decided to cancel and get their full deposits back at the 11th hour.
